Career path

Career Role Description
Earthquake Insurance Claims Adjuster Investigate and assess earthquake damage to properties, determining payouts based on policy terms. High demand due to increased seismic activity awareness.
Earthquake Insurance Claims Specialist (Catastrophe Modelling) Utilize advanced modelling techniques to predict potential losses and inform underwriting decisions. Specialized skillset highly sought after by major insurers.
Earthquake Loss Control Consultant Advise clients on risk mitigation strategies to minimize earthquake damage. Growing demand as preventative measures gain prominence.
Earthquake Insurance Underwriter Assess risk and determine appropriate premiums for earthquake insurance policies. Requires understanding of geological factors and actuarial principles.
